Preston High dance team and varsity cheerleaders spar over halftime time, music and safety at board meeting

Preston County Board of Education · December 20, 2025

Summary

A debate over scheduling, music and safety between Preston High’s new dance club and the varsity cheer program drew parents, coaches and board questions. Dance co-sponsors asked for regular three‑minute halftime slots; the varsity coach warned of safety risks when music drowned out counts during stunts and urged preservation of cheerleaders' traditional performance time.

Members of the public, coaches and board members discussed competing claims about halftime performances, music control and safety at Preston High School during the Dec. 17 board meeting.

Jeff Zigray, a community member who asked to speak about the dance team, raised concerns about short timeouts and music play during timeouts that interfered with cheerleader routines. "Some of the music I felt was a little concerning," he said, describing a music selection with a violent-movie reference that parents found inappropriate for young spectators.

Britney Carpenter, who identified herself as co-sponsor of the Preston High dance team, said the club seeks only modest performance time and uses no district funds: "We're not taking any funding... the girls provide all of their own stuff," she told the board. Carpenter asked for regular three-minute halftime opportunities and said the dance team was not organized to compete with cheerleaders.
